**Hoarder: A Fresh Take on Cleaning Simulators from the Co-Creator of Darkwood**

The gaming community is buzzing with excitement over the recent revelation from Byzel, a development team associated with the board game company Awaken Realms. Guided by Gustaw Stachaszewski, co-founder of Acid Wizard, the team is delving into the world of cleaning simulators with their forthcoming title, “Hoarder.” Renowned for his contribution to the critically acclaimed horror title “Darkwood,” Stachaszewski is now venturing into a different genre, yet with a distinct twist.

“Hoarder” initially appears as a cleaning simulator, drawing parallels to well-known games such as “PowerWash Simulator” and “Viscera Cleanup Detail.” However, it vows to deliver far more than merely organizing virtual environments. As players immerse themselves in the game, they will reveal concealed secrets that convert the experience into a completely different type of game, echoing the genre-blending “Inscryption.”

The Byzel development team, whose name translates to “mess” or “clutter” in Polish, comprises talents from various successful ventures. This includes contributors to the innovative time management FPS “Superhot” and the YouTube horror series “Poradnik Uśmiechu” (Smile Guide). This eclectic background suggests the creative possibilities driving “Hoarder.”
